AB is parallel to CD we have to find value of x

The Corresponding Angles Theorem says that: If a transversal cuts two parallel lines, their corresponding angles are congruent

So by the corresponding angles theorem we get Angle COE as 75° = Angle ABO

Note - We have named the point O where line CD intersects line BE

=> Now , we know that Angle COE + y = 180°

( Linear pair )

=> 75 + y = 180

=> y = 180 - 75

=> y = 105°

Now by using angle sum property let us find measure of x

=> 105 + 30 + x = 180

=> 135 + x = 180

=> x = 180 - 135

=> x = 45

Hence , Angle x is 45°
